The Superior 134x3 ball bearing is suitable for a wide range of industrial applications, including but not limited to:
1. **Automotive Industry**: The bearing is commonly used in automotive applications such as powertrains, steering systems, and suspension systems, where it provides high load-carrying capacity and durability.
2. **Machine Tools**: The bearing is ideal for machine tools, such as lathes, milling machines, and grinding machines, where it ensures smooth and precise movement.
3. **Industrial Equipment**: The bearing is widely used in industrial equipment, such as conveyors, pumps, and compressors, where it contributes to the overall performance and reliability of the equipment.

To ensure optimal performance and longevity of the Superior 134x3 ball bearing, the following solutions are recommended:
1. **Proper Installation**: Ensure that the bearing is properly installed in the application, following the manufacturer's guidelines. This includes using the correct mounting tools and techniques.
2. **Regular Maintenance**: Regularly inspect and maintain the bearing to identify any signs of wear or damage. This may involve cleaning, lubrication, and replacement of worn-out components.
3. **Selecting the Right Application**: Choose the right application for the Superior 134x3 ball bearing, considering factors such as load, speed, and environmental conditions. This will help ensure that the bearing operates within its design limits and performs optimally.
